    Google Adsense has informed me that I now need an ads.txt file – which I have uploaded to public_html, now I just need to know if the sitemap will pick it up?

    The ads.txt file is an optional, non-standard directive which proponents, like Google Adsense, will look for periodically and automatically.

    The sitemap.xml file yields a standard protocol which informs search engines of indexable documents that are available for crawling. The catch is that Google expects every item in this file should be for humans, too. The ads.txt file is not for humans, and therefore, it shouldn’t be in the sitemap.

    There’s a lot more to it than this, but the gist is that it’s redundant and counter-productive to add it to the sitemap.
